RuneScape is a timeless MMO, but it is not the only project by Jagex. Deep in the internet vaults lies a minigame website that once sat alongside the hit MMO. Funorb.

    Hey! Thanks for checking out the Alterorb and Funorb remake projects! I'm one the developers and staff members for a few of these. Notably, Arcanists and Chrome Conflict (the full remake and continuation of Steel Sentinels including a 3D version of the game). I hope you have enjoyed your time looking through all of the projects and history of them. Sadly, many years of progress, planning, artwork, models, music, etc have been lost due to Forum closures and lost links for time. It still amazes me how many talented people came out of the shadows to breathe new life into these beloved games, not to mention that some of these have turned from a passion project into full playable games with a team dedicated to working on them.
